EMMA is an open source toolkit for measuring and reporting Java code coverage. EMMA is distributed under the terms of Common Public License v1.0.

EMMA is not currently under active development; the last stable release took place in mid-2005.[1] EMMA works by wrapping each line of code and each condition with a flag, which is set when that line is executed.[2]
